Que es el algoritmo round robin?
¿Qué es el algoritmo round robin?
Round-Robin es un algoritmo de planificación de procesos simple de implementar, dentro de un sistema operativo se asigna a cada proceso una porción de tiempo equitativa y ordenada, tratando a todos los procesos con la misma prioridad.
¿Cómo hacer un algoritmo round robin?
Algoritmo de Round Robin El algoritmo consiste en definir una unidad de tiempo pequeña, llamada “quantum” o “cuanto” de tiempo, la cual es asignada a cada proceso que esté en estado listo. Si el proceso agota su quantum (Q) de tiempo, se elige a otro proceso para ocupar la CPU.
¿Cómo funciona el algoritmo de prioridad?
En este algoritmo a cada proceso se le asocia un número entero de prioridad. Mientras menor sea este entero pues mayor prioridad tiene el proceso, por lo que la escencia del algoritmo es planificar la entrada de procesos a la CPU de acuerdo a la prioridad asociada de cada uno de ellos.
¿Cómo trabaja el algoritmo de planificacion FIFO First In First Out?
Empezaremos hablando de FCFS o también llamado FIFO (del inglés First In, First Out). Este algoritmo es muy sencillo y simple, pero también el que menos rendimiento ofrece, básicamente en este algoritmo el primer proceso que llega se ejecuta y una vez terminado se ejecuta el siguiente.
¿Qué tareas principales se desarrollan dentro de la función planificación de procesos?
La Planificación de procesos tiene como principales objetivos la equidad, la eficacia, el tiempo de respuesta, el tiempo de regreso y el rendimiento. Tiempo de respuesta: El tiempo empleado en dar respuesta a las solicitudes del usuario debe ser el menor posible.
¿Que deben garantizar los algoritmo de planificacion?
En cuanto al Algoritmo de Planificación se debe garantizar que estos sean: Equitativos o Imparciales. Cada proceso recibe una parte justa de tiempo. Minimizar el tiempo de espera por salida de los trabajos por lotes.
¿Qué son las políticas de planificación?
La planificación es proceso de establecer metas y elegir medios para alcanzarlas. Como ejercicio de anticipación, enfoque prospectivo de la realidad, disponer de la mayor información relevante y sus probables desarrollos es requerido.
¿Qué es el tiempo de respuesta de un proceso?
El tiempo de respuesta o tiempo de reacción hace referencia a la cantidad de tiempo que transcurre desde que percibimos algo hasta que damos una respuesta en consecuencia. Por tanto, es la capacidad de detectar, procesar y dar respuesta a un estímulo.
¿Cuál es el tiempo de respuesta de un humano?
· El tiempo de reacción promedio del humano es de 0,25 segundos frente a un estímulo visual, 0,17 para un estímulo auditivo, y 0,15 segundos frente a un estímulo táctil.
¿Qué tan importante es el tiempo de respuesta?
Cuanto menor tiempo de respuesta tenga un monitor más nitidez habrá en las imágenes en movimiento. A la hora de ver la tele, el tiempo de respuesta no suele ser muy importante, pero en los videojuegos sí puede cambiar la calidad de tu experiencia, aunque esto no siempre es así.
¿Qué parte del sistema operativo que se encarga de decidir que proceso emplea el procesador en cada instante?
El planificador de procesos (process scheduler, en inglés) es la parte del sistema operativo que se encarga de seleccionar a qué proceso se asigna el recurso procesador y durante cuánto tiempo.
¿Cuáles son colas que administra el sistema operativo?
El sistema operativo mantiene las siguientes colas importantes de programación de procesos:
- Cola de trabajos: esta cola mantiene todos los procesos en el sistema.
- Cola lista: esta cola mantiene un conjunto de todos los procesos que residen en la memoria principal, listos y en espera de ejecución.
¿Qué es un proceso en un sistema operativo?
Definición de Proceso El principal concepto en cualquier sistema operativo es el de proceso. Un proceso es un programa en ejecución, incluyendo el valor del program counter, los registros y las variables. Conceptualmente, cada proceso tiene un hilo (thread) de ejecución que es visto como un CPU virtual.
